Some of you will already know WizWom, the Wizard Wombat - I've been offering thoughts randomly for over 30 years on social sites, back to the days of FIDONET and Usenet over dial-up. One of the issues that has always been a part of this is the bility to censor. Usenet was the best, because of its multiple path/multiple share transmission system. But they worked out how to do blacklists for sites and accounts, mostly to combat spam - but anything that can stop one type of message can stop any type of message.
And Microsoft has been acquiring social media; what wasn't already censored by government intervention is radidly turning that way. you don't have to get a facebook ban more than once for some innocuous flame war before you know the platform only survives by inertia. And I've seen inertia blow away like the wind - does anyone remember DejaVu?

So - I am a voluntarist. I believe the only way we should interact is voluntary association and free interchange. I believe using force or fraud to achieve things is evil, even when voted on by more than 50% of the "important" people. If an idea is good enough to get that much support, then it can damn well be funded without theft from those who dislike it.

I have a family and I want my son to grow up happy and free, to be a light to the world. I want him to be able to stand against tyrants, with intelligence and planning to do it as safely as possible. Agorism can only go so far against Tyrrany, I think.

I think, though, the thing that will provide the best possibility of peace is helping everyone to live a good, prosperous happy life, for everyone on the planet to see a path to comfort and pleasure. The resources that we know about on the planet are plenty to let everyone earn a life as free from worry as a moden American. Energy is a desperate need to do this, and Nuclear Power is the only technology which can do it at all. (Oh, the fossil fuel is there - but the would need about 4x the current amount of power available, and that is a hell of a lot of coal being mined day in and day out.) So I learned nuclear engineering and published a master's thesis, Feasibility Study of a Nuclear Power Plant With No Moving Parts. i put my time and effort behind what I believe in.
